There are many brands out there to chose from. every shop wants you to believe that their's is the best & you should by from them.
The best thing to do is go to several different places look, touch & listen. If it sounds good on the board it should sound good in your car. But not always. An in-car listening test is always better.
Arm yourself with as much knowledge as you can gather & then figure out your budget.
If you wish to do it in stages. I have been collecting gear for years, some old & some new. then I decide what gonna be done 1st. To get better sound as cheap as possible to start decide if changing HU is what you really want. then do it. Add new speakers at same time or add later.
Another thing most over looked is the speaker wire.Swaping the factory wire for quality wire will help also. Its more work but worth it.
Then subs... but I could go on forever about that subject.
Enjoy in what you do, & if it turns out you don't like it... just change it.
